    Commonwealth Youth Organization Joins Forces Against Drug Abuse In Ogun

    The Commonwealth Youth Organization of Nigeria, Ogun State Chapter, led by Comrade Ojo Emmanuel, united with several youth-led organizations to mark this year  International Day Against Drug Abuse and Illicit Trafficking in th  state .

     This global event, themed “The Evidence is Clear; Invest in Prevention,” aims to bolster international cooperation and action towards eliminating drug abuse and illicit trafficking worldwide.

    PLATFORM TIMES gathered that in Ogun State, the commemoration kicked off with an awareness campaign commencing from the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ency’s office in Ibara, Abeokuta, extending through various parts of the city. 

    PLATFORM TIMES reports that the aim was  to fostering awareness about the perils of drug abuse, endorsing evidence-based prevention and treatment strategies, advocating  policies that tackle the root causes of substance misuse, and promoting unity against illicit trafficking and organized crime.

    Comrade Ojo Emmanuel, speaking on behalf of the Commonwealth Youth Organization, said  the pivotal role of youth in combating drug abuse within local communities.

     He highlighted the imperative for educational initiatives that empower young people with knowledge about the dangers of drugs, as well as the importance of supportive interventions and policy frameworks that can effectively curb the prevalence of drug-related issues.

    The event garnered participation from a diverse array of stakeholders, including government representatives, civil society organizations, and concerned citizens, all rallying together to reinforce the message of prevention and solidarity against drug abuse.

     PLATFORM TIMES reports that the International Day Against Drug Abuse and Illicit Trafficking served as a poignant reminder of the collective responsibility shared by communities and individuals alike in safeguarding public health and promoting social well-being amidst the challenges posed by substance abuse and trafficking.
